I guess I missed an alternative to Rickrolling – You’ve been Barackroll’d!

Although this is a commercial for a Toyota Carolla, am I crazy for wishing this was an entire movie?

And it was a toss up between the video below or this one to define “laughably bad.”  Whereas this clip below is an homage to bad, the CGI dinosaur is simply bad.